Additional Information on Arbitrary Waveforms
• Press the Arb key to output the arbitrary waveform currently
selected (to scroll through the waveform choices and make a
selection, press
Arb List ).
• In addition to creating a new arbitrary waveform from the front
panel, you can also edit any existing user-defined waveforms. You can
edit waveforms created either from the front panel or from the
remote interface. However, you cannot edit any of the five built-in
arbitrary waveforms.
Use the “
GET” option under the NEW ARB command in the EDIT MENU
to load an existing user-defined waveform. Then, use the LINE EDIT,
POINT EDIT, and INVERT commands to edit the waveform.
• The
INVERT command in the EDIT MENU takes the inverse of each
point in the specified waveform by changing the sign.
• You can use the
DELETE command in the EDIT MENU to delete any
user-defined waveforms in volatile memory. A list of all user-defined
waveforms appears when you move to the
DELETE command.
